Design and Aesthetics

Both KitchenAid and GE Profile refrigerators offer a wide range of styles and finishes to complement any kitchen design. KitchenAid refrigerators are known for their iconic professional-grade aesthetics, often featuring bold colors like red, black, and stainless steel. Their sleek, minimalist designs exude a modern and sophisticated vibe.

GE Profile refrigerators, on the other hand, offer a more contemporary and minimalist approach. They prioritize sleek lines, integrated handles, and subtle accents, creating a clean and uncluttered look. Many GE Profile models feature fingerprint-resistant finishes, making them ideal for busy kitchens.

Ultimately, the choice between the two brands comes down to personal preference. Do you prefer a bold statement piece like a KitchenAid refrigerator, or a more subtle and modern approach like a GE Profile model?

Features and Technology

Both brands boast a wide range of innovative features and technologies designed to enhance convenience and efficiency. Here’s a breakdown of some key features:

KitchenAid:

  • Preserva Food Preservation System: This system utilizes advanced humidity and temperature control to maintain optimal freshness for fruits, vegetables, and other perishable items.
  • Custom-Adjustable Shelves: KitchenAid refrigerators often feature adjustable shelves that can be easily rearranged to accommodate different sized items.
  • Ice and Water Dispensers: Many models come with built-in ice and water dispensers for easy access to cold beverages.
  • Smart Features: Some KitchenAid refrigerators offer smart connectivity features, allowing you to control settings, monitor temperature, and even order groceries remotely.

GE Profile:

  • TwinChill Evaporators: This technology separates the refrigerator and freezer compartments, ensuring optimal humidity and temperature control for both sections.
  • Adjustable Humidity Drawers: GE Profile refrigerators often feature adjustable humidity drawers that allow you to customize the environment for different types of produce.
  • Water Filtration System: Many models come with built-in water filtration systems to provide clean and refreshing drinking water.
  • Smart Features: GE Profile refrigerators offer a range of smart features, including voice control, remote monitoring, and even the ability to diagnose potential issues.

Performance and Efficiency

Both KitchenAid and GE Profile refrigerators are known for their reliable performance and energy efficiency. However, there are some key differences to consider:

KitchenAid:

  • Strong Cooling Performance: KitchenAid refrigerators generally excel in maintaining consistent temperatures throughout the entire unit.
  • Efficient Energy Consumption: Most KitchenAid models are Energy Star certified, indicating their energy efficiency.
  • Quiet Operation: KitchenAid refrigerators are known for their quiet operation, minimizing noise distractions in the kitchen.

GE Profile:

  • Advanced Temperature Control: GE Profile refrigerators utilize advanced temperature control systems to ensure optimal freshness for all types of food.
  • Excellent Energy Efficiency: GE Profile refrigerators are often rated highly for their energy efficiency, helping you save money on your electricity bill.
  • Durable Construction: GE Profile refrigerators are built with durable materials and construction, ensuring long-lasting performance.
